Due to the size of the mechanism that I&#8217;m using, I need to use the FGM model to speed up this study. My problem with using the FGM model is its treatment of the laminar flame speed when none of the fuel species native to the software is included in the tabulation. Even though I&#8217;m using pure ammonia fuel, the model uses methane characteristics to calculate the flame speed, which is a massive discrepancy. Is there anyway that I can tell the model to use ammonia&#8217;s characteristics for the flame speed calculations instead of me manually inputting those values?&lt;\/p&gt;&lt;p&gt;Thanks in advance,&lt;\/p&gt;<\/p>\n","protected":false},"template":"","class_list":["post-392416","topic","type-topic","status-publish","hentry"],"aioseo_notices":[],"acf":[],"custom_fields":[{"0":{"_bbp_subscription":["302346","14415"],"_bbp_author_ip":["149.149.2.104"],"_btv_view_count":["161"],"_bbp_topic_status":["unanswered"],"_bbp_topic_id":["392416"],"_bbp_forum_id":["27792"],"_bbp_engagement":["14415","302346"],"_bbp_voice_count":["2"],"_bbp_reply_count":["7"],"_bbp_last_reply_id":["393033"],"_bbp_last_active_id":["393033"],"_bbp_last_active_time":["2024-11-06 16:54:11"]},"test":"abtharpe42tntech-edu"}],"_links":{"self":[{"href":"https:\/\/innovationspace.ansys.com\/forum\/wp-json\/wp\/v2\/topics\/392416","targetHints":{"allow":["GET"]}}],"collection":[{"href":"https:\/\/innovationspace.ansys.com\/forum\/wp-json\/wp\/v2\/topics"}],"about":[{"href":"https:\/\/innovationspace.ansys.com\/forum\/wp-json\/wp\/v2\/types\/topic"}],"version-history":[{"count":0,"href":"https:\/\/innovationspace.ansys.com\/forum\/wp-json\/wp\/v2\/topics\/392416\/revisions"}],"wp:attachment":[{"href":"https:\/\/innovationspace.ansys.com\/forum\/wp-json\/wp\/v2\/media?parent=392416"}],"curies":[{"name":"wp","href":"https:\/\/api.w.org\/{rel}","templated":true}]}}
